Annual video game summit The Tokyo Game Show is in full swing right now in Japan, and crawling out of the region today is a concept trailer for “Silent Hills”, the new entry into the venerable franchise. Spearheaded by “Metal Gear” creator Hideo Kojima and Guillermo del Toro, the game was first announced last month courtesy of a compelling teaser starring Norman Reedus.

The new trailer offers up some conceptual gameplay from the game, and it frankly looks creepy as f*ck.

Here is what del Toro had to say about his involvement in the project:

“We talked about concepts and tools at his headquarters in Tokyo,” del Toro said. “Then he sent his first version of the playable teaser. I saw it loved it. We then… exchanged ideas and the result was the playable teaser you see now.

The concepts we’re discussing, the ideas that we’re discussing and the tools that are in play to create Silent Hills are going to render an incredibly intense and an incredibly scary game.”
